Bhatt quits Yes Bank CEO search panel

November 15, 2018 10:48 pm | Updated 10:48 pm IST - Mumbai

Former SBI chairman O.P. Bhatt has resigned from the search panel which was formed to find a successor for Yes Bank MD & CEO Rana Kapoor, citing conflict of interest. Mr. Bhatt has attended three meetings of the search committee.

“The NRC (nomination and remuneration committee) has decided to continue with the existing members to complete the process as per the timeline communicated by RBI,” Yes Bank said in a regulatory filing.

Shares of Yes Bank declined 7.42% on Thursday, a day after its non-executive chairman Ashok Chawla, who was named in the CBI chargesheet in the Aircel-Maxis case, resigned.
